Unlock Full ReportNapkin AI is a visual AI tool that transforms text into various insightful visuals such as infographics, diagrams, and charts. It aims to make communication more effective by providing an intuitive platform where users can import text and generate editable visuals without needing to write prompts. The platform supports customization, team collaboration, and export to multiple file formats.

Napkin AI aligns well with the concept of an AI-powered content creation tool, specifically for visual content. It features a 'no-prompting' approach where users input text and the AI generates visuals, which is a form of 'guided tool interface'. It offers 'built-in styles and fonts' and the ability to 'create custom styles' which matches 'creative presets & styles'. The pricing page clearly indicates 'user authentication & subscriptions' with free, Plus, and Pro tiers. The platform allows 'export and integrations' to various formats like PPT, PNG, PDF, and SVG. While not explicitly a 'tool catalog', it focuses on generating various visual types (infographics, diagrams, mind maps, flowcharts, data charts). It supports 'multi-language support' for content generation in 60+ languages. The 'Help Center' and 'How it works' sections serve as 'in-app resources & tutorials'. The 'Teamspace' and 'Real-time Editing' features directly support 'collaboration and sharing'. The ability to 'create custom styles using your brand colors, fonts, etc. inside Napkin using our style builder' aligns with 'custom-prompt-templates' in the context of visual styles.
